Output 2f7e24d2417c053a138e368d80e48d89d5e9a2fb5866519e540f44ecb2135718:4

value
24152079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6172503699b548666df33f964466f68112c0bf72 OP_EQUAL
address
3AaGQnFKLyoDadptwdGVs3WhtQRdCsuVC1
transaction
2f7e24d2417c053a138e368d80e48d89d5e9a2fb5866519e540f44ecb2135718
confirmations
358148
spent
true